The Current Firmware Version appears at the top of the page.
STEP 1 Click Browse to locate and select the firmware that you downloaded from
Cisco.com.
STEP 2 If you want to abandon your current configuration settings and restore the default
settings during the upgrade process, check Reset all configuration / settings to
factory defaults. Uncheck the box to retain your current configuration settings.
STEP 3 Choose Start Firmware Upgrade. After the new firmware image is validated, the
new image is written to flash, and the router is automatically rebooted with the
new firmware.
After the router reboots and you log in, you can use the Status > System Summary
page to verify that the new firmware is installed. See Viewing the System
Summary, page 196.
Rebooting the Cisco RV220W
Use the Administration > Reboot Router to reboot the router by using the
Configuration Utility.
To open this page: In the navigation tree, choose Administration > Reboot
Router.
Click Reboot to proceed.
Restoring the Factory Defaults
Use the Administration > Restore Factory Defaults page if you want to abandon
your current configuration settings and restore the factory default settings for the
Cisco RV220W.
To open this page: In the navigation tree, choose Administration > Restore
Factory Defaults.
Click Default to proceed.
NOTE Alternatively, to restore the factory defaults during a firmware upgrade, see
Firmware Upgrade, page 189.
